AFC Wildcard Jets @ Bengals Preview

The New York Jets destroyed the Cincinnati Bengals last week 37-0 to get into the playoffs. I know the Bengals had nothing to play for and sat some of their starters, but the Jets hammered them. The Bengals must be concerned the Jets were able to run for 257 yards on the ground. The Jets managed to score 37 points with Mark Sanchez only completing 8 passes. Look for the Jets to try and reapply this formula today.

This game should be a tightly contested, hard hitting, slugfest. The Jets are first in most defensive categories and the Bengals were 4th in yards allowed and 6th in points against. In addition this game will be outdoors with the temperature around 25 at the start of the game.

As I have pointed out a few times on my Power Rankings I have been very concerned about the Bengals offense the second half of the season espaecially the play of Carson Palmer. The Bengals have an elite QB but have him playing a very safe style like a Kyle Orton. Carson has thrown for over 225 yards only once in his last 9 games. That coincides with Chad Ochocinco only having one 100+ yard game in his last 9 games as well. I think the Bengals are going to have a very hard time moving the ball today.

I think the Jets will just ask Mark Sanchez to manage the game. THe Jets will want to play a turnover free game and if they can they will win. Sanchez had 20 interceptions during the season and the Jets can't afford for him to make mistakes. The Jets will run the rock, run it some more and punt whenever they need to.

Overall I believe the Jets secondary will just be too much for the Bengals to handle. The Jets are playing with an attitude of a tough nosed bulldog. Darrelle Revis and Lito Sheppard will absolutely shutdown the Bengals passing game turning this into a Thomas Jones vs. Cedric Benson battle. Overall this game is very even I just think the Jets will continue to win with ball control and outstanding defense. The Jets have not allowed more that 15 point in their last six contests. Rex Ryan is going to have his team mentally ready for war today.

Prediction New York Jets 16 - Cincinnati 13
